Have a gunsmith check the chamber dimensions. It could be that the chamber is slightly undersize. If it is, that would be a fairly easy fix.
 

rodfac

New member
I'd strip the bolt/frame hole that encloses the firing pin...clean it thoroughly with electrical contact cleaner and while doing it, check for any burrs. My P290 has had one light strike/failure to fire that fired on the 2nd attempt...I've cleaned mine with no further issues. Short of that, I'd call Sig again and tell 'em you've still got problems.
